CloverETL and Talend Data Fabric are data integration platforms. Talend Data Fabric appears to have the upper hand due to its extensive features and value.
Features: CloverETL provides robust data transformation, flexibility, and easy script execution for complex workflows. Talend Data Fabric offers a wide range of integration connectors, real-time analytics, and strong data governance, outweighing CloverETL's customization advantages.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Talend Data Fabric has an intuitive deployment process for cloud and on-premise environments with comprehensive support. CloverETL allows for smooth deployment with flexible configurations, but its support is less comprehensive than Talend's. Talend provides significant adaptability in deployment.
Pricing and ROI: CloverETL offers a cost-effective model and quick setup for good short-term ROI. Talend Data Fabric, though more expensive, delivers strong long-term ROI with enhanced data insights and management. The financial investment in Talend is offset by long-term benefits.
Talend, a leader in cloud data integration and data integrity, enables companies to transform by delivering trusted data at the speed of business.
Talend Data Fabric offers a single suite of apps that shorten the time to trusted data. Users can collect data across systems; govern it to ensure proper use, transform it into new formats and improve quality, and share it with internal and external stakeholders.
Over 3,000 global enterprise customers have chosen Talend to help them turn all their raw data into trusted data to make business decisions with confidence — including GE, HP Inc., and Domino’s.
